
Technical manual
(1)Module information
Product name:TPMS SENSOR
Model name:TMSS6F2
Brand:BH SENS
Manufacture Name:Baolong Huf Shanghai Electronics Co., Ltd.
Address:No. Building 3, Lane 1099, Zhangjing Road, Dongjing Town, Songjiang District, Shanghai City,
P.R. China
Power:Battery(3.0V)
Rated current:<10mA
Operating frequency :315MHz or 433.92Mhz
Modulation Frequency deviation:±45KHz
Transmit Power:<5 mW
Modulation:FSK
RF code:Manchester
Antenna gain:-25dBi
Receiver Low frequency:125kHz
Modulation:ASK
LF code:Manchester
Operating temperature range:-40℃~+125℃
Software version:V1.0
Hardware version:V3.0
The module is powered by 3V battery, the RF center frequency is 315MHz or 433.92Mhz, the
modulation frequency deviation is ±45KHz, and the modulation mode is FSK. In normal operation
mode, the sensor function module will periodically detect the tire internal pressure and temperature
information. The real-time data collected is sent to the receiver by RF circuit. In addition, the pressure,
temperature, sensor ID and other information inside the tire can be read in real time through the
hand-held low-frequency tool.

(2)Diagram introduction
Description:
1. This module contains a highly integrated chip, which includes microprocessor core, pressure sensor,
temperature sensor, acceleration sensor and RF function module. The RF center frequency is
433.92Mhz or 315MHz.
2. The module is powered by 3V battery. During the working period of the sensor, the microprocessor
periodically reads the pressure and temperature information inside the tire through the pressure sensor
and temperature sensor.
3. This module uses crystal oscillator circuit recommended by chip to provide accurate clock
frequency for microprocessor.
4. As the core of the sensor, the microprocessor sensor function module is responsible for collecting
tire pressure, temperature, acceleration and other information.
5. The sensor contains low-frequency function module, which is used for hand-held tools to read
real-time data of sensor or upgrade software.
